Exploring beyond your gay boutique hotel in Schmallenberg
Once you've settled into your fabulous gay boutique hotel in Schmallenberg, you're ready to conquer the town. Take a stroll down Hauptstraße, the city's main street, lined with charming shops and cafés. Be sure to visit the Schmallenberg City Museum, a veritable treasure trove of local history. For a touch of nature, the Rothaarsteig is a must-visit. It's a long-distance hiking trail that offers breathtaking views of the Sauerland region. And for a hidden gem, check out Café Pano. This quaint café offers the best coffee in town, not to mention an array of scrumptious cakes that are sure to satisfy your sweet tooth. If you’re yearning for a larger city with more queer culture, consider a day trip to nearby Cologne. It’s just a couple of hours away and boasts a vibrant LGBTQ+ scene.
